Position Summary

The Department of Individual, Family, & Community Education seeks to hire temporary part-time faculty to teach in the fields of Nutrition, Counselor Education, Educational Psychology, and Family and Child Studies.

The Department of IFCE houses four diverse, but interconnected, programs that prepare students to address the myriad issues faced by the State of New Mexico.

Our faculty members are leaders in their disciplines of Counselor Education, Educational Psychology, Family and Child Studies, and Nutrition; although each of these programs reflect different professional fields and identities, we all have shared values of human development, diversity, and excellence in scholarship and teaching.

Positions are contingent upon need each semester as determined by student enrollment, course offering, and demand driven by graduation requirements.

Positions may be filled or eliminated each semester up to the deadline for students to drop or add courses.

Candidates who are selected for these positions will report to the IFCE Department Chair.

These positions will remain open until filled.

Qualifications

Minimum Qualifications

1.Master’s in Nutrition, Counselor Education, Family and Child Studies, Educational Psychology, or a closely related field

Preferred Qualifications

1.Doctoral or scholarly work in an area relevant to the course. 2.Potential to teach online or certification or experience in online teaching. 3.Potential to teach or demonstrated ability to teach at the college level. 4.A demonstrated commitment to cultivate an understanding of the rich and varied cultures of New Mexico and to the success of the university's mission to serve local and global communities. 5.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
